A clogged toilet in Kerrville, TX, may seem like a minor inconvenience, but if not addressed promptly, it can lead to severe structural damage in your home. The potential risks go beyond a simple overflow. When water backs up, it can spread, affecting floors, walls, and even the foundation, potentially leading to long-term issues and expensive repairs.

1. Water Damage  

Water from the toilet can overflow onto your floors, damaging wood, tiles, and carpeting. If left untreated, the water seeps into the subfloor and walls, weakening structural components and encouraging mold growth.

2. Mold and Mildew Growth  

Standing water creates the perfect environment for mold and mildew to thrive. This can lead to health issues and further damage to your home’s materials, including framing, drywall, and insulation.

3. Damage to Plumbing  

Over time, the pressure of a backed-up toilet can weaken your pipes. Constant blockage can cause pipes to burst, creating leaks that can lead to serious water damage in various parts of your home.

4. Foundation Problems  

In extreme cases, water damage from a toilet can impact your home’s foundation. Prolonged moisture exposure can cause the foundation to shift, leading to cracks and instability.

5. Increased Repair Costs  

The longer you wait to address a blocked toilet, the more extensive the damage can become. Fixing a minor clog can prevent costly plumbing repairs in Kerrville, TX, related to water damage, mold remediation, or plumbing replacement.

Ignoring a congested toilet can cause serious and costly structural damage to your home. Address plumbing issues promptly to protect your property and your wallet.
